抽奖狂欢!转盘小程序如何实现屏幕录制

抖音小程序 2023-12-28 14:01:07 32
抽奖狂欢!转盘小程序如何实现屏幕录制

在当下火热的移动互联网时代,抽奖活动已经成为各大企业、商家吸引用户关注、提高用户粘性的常用手段。为了让抽奖活动更具吸引力,不少开发者纷纷将目光投向了屏幕录制领域,希望通过实时录制奖品抽取过程,让用户感受到更加直观、公正的抽奖体验。本文将为您介绍如何利用转盘小程序实现屏幕录制功能。

一、准备工作

  • 1. 选择一款合适的屏幕录制工具。市面上有许多屏幕录制软件,如OBS Studio、XSplit Gamecaster等,都可以满足开发需求。
  • 2. 获取屏幕录制软件的开发接口。大部分屏幕录制软件都提供了开发者接口,通过这些接口,我们可以控制软件进行实时录制。
  • 3. 准备一台服务器。为了确保录制视频能够实时传输到小程序,我们需要准备一台具备公网IP和服务器资源的服务器。

二、实现转盘小程序

  • 1. 设计转盘页面。在小程序中创建一个转盘页面,展示转盘、奖品信息以及实时录制按钮等元素。
  • 2. 实现转盘旋转动画。可以利用小程序的动画能力,为转盘添加旋转动画,使其看起来更具动感。
  • 3. 添加实时录制功能。在转盘页面中添加一个按钮,用于启动或暂停录制。当用户点击该按钮时,触发录制操作。

三、整合屏幕录制软件

抽奖狂欢!转盘小程序如何实现屏幕录制

  • 1. 初始化录制软件。在小程序中,调用屏幕录制软件的开发者接口,初始化录制环境,如设置录制画面、音频源等。
  • 2. 开始录制。当用户点击实时录制按钮时,调用录制软件的接口启动录制。
  • 3. 结束录制。当录制完成后,调用录制软件的接口停止录制,并通知服务器上传视频。

四、视频上传与播放

  • 1. 视频上传。将录制好的视频上传至服务器,可以使用HTTP上传或者第三方云存储服务。
  • 2. 视频播放。在小程序中添加一个视频播放器,加载上传至服务器的视频,让用户实时观看抽奖过程。

通过以上步骤,我们可以实现一个具备实时录制功能的转盘小程序。当然,根据实际需求,我们还可以为小程序添加更多功能,如倒计时、抽奖规则说明等。让抽奖活动变得更加公正、有趣,吸引更多用户参与!

The End